Lloyd Spencer on Opening Up About His Sexuality on Below Deck Med: "It's Liberating"

The deckhand showed his gratitude "for all the support" he has received since the emotional Season 6 moment.

By Laura Rosenfeld
Lloyd Spencer Below Deck Med

In the August 9 episode of Below Deck Mediterranean, Lloyd Spencer experienced an emotional moment with the crew as he opened up about his sexuality. Katie Flood, Malia White, and David Pascoe rallied around the deckhand as he shared that he was "treated like a piece of s--t by my captain" and encountered hate speech during a past yachting job.

Lloyd opened up about the supportive moment during a recent interview with E! News. "The word inspiring comes to mind. It was unexpected but incredibly inspiring. The initial response from Katie [Flood] was just so, so, so supportive, and then to have pretty much the rest of the crew all just come over at that moment and give me that level of support," he shared. "But I think the greatest thing was when I woke up in the morning and I was exceptionally worried about it. You wake up, you're a little hungover, and you realize you said that on television and it's going to be aired, and every single one of them came up to me throughout the next day and offered their support again. Absolutely nothing changed onboard and they all continued then and they're continuing now to offer me the same level of support."

The deckhand went on to share more about the homophobia he experienced during his previous job in yachting. "I worked on a small boat where I was very, very close-knit with the people I was working with onboard, so it wasn't a case of being able to avoid that person and that person was the person in charge. It was pretty full-on from the minute I woke up to the minute I went to bed," he said. "It wasn't a very nice person, not in normal terms: wouldn't say good morning, was exceptionally rude. But when it came to comments he made about other people that we saw walking past the dock and then also comments about myself were very hard to deal with."

Lloyd also confirmed how he identifies himself after saying that he was "90 percent straight" in the latest episode of Below Deck Med. "Yeah the 90 percent straight thing was my realization that I said it on television and kind of trying to stop it from spiraling to a full confessional of my entire life, but if I were to put it in a statement of such, I completely believe in like a fluid spectrum and as any part of my life, I might move on that spectrum up or down. It just depends on the time in my life. It depends on where I am," he said. "I personally feel like everyone is on that spectrum. People may be a bit more than others and I certainly have my experiences where I've been up and down on that."

Lloyd told E! News that "it's liberating" to watch the moment back in the episode, and he has since "had nothing but support" from the Below Deck Med crew, as well as fans on social media.

The deckhand thanked everyone "for all the support" on Twitter and confirmed in another tweet that he felt "surrounded by love," as one fan put it, during the episode. "After being terrified about how this episode would be received," Lloyd also tweeted on August 10. "I just wanted to say thank you for all the kind messages."

The moment has had a profound effect on viewers and Lloyd's crewmates alike, including Malia, who had tears in her eyes while speaking about some of the intolerance that still exists in the yachting industry during an interview in the episode. Malia opened up about getting emotional in that instance during a recent interview with The Daily Dish, sharing that it was "just heartbreaking" to hear what Lloyd went through with his previous crew. "You just meet these amazing personalities, and you want them to shine," she said.

"I think that moment was really special 'cause it was like everyone just saying to Lloyd, you know, it doesn’t matter," Malia continued. "You can be exactly who you want to be, and none of us are gonna care."

During his appearance on Watch What Happens Live with Andy Cohen on August 9, David also applauded Lloyd for sharing his truth. "Oh, bless him," he said of his fellow deckhand in the below clip. "I'm just happy that he was amongst people he could be open with, and we were there for him. That was the main thing."

Earlier that day, David tweeted about the moment, "Nothing but love for my boy [Lloyd]," who replied, "You have been nothing but incredible."

Lloyd also showed some love to Katie in a post on Instagram on August 10, thanking her "for keeping me smiling." Katie responded by praising Lloyd in the comments of his post. "I am so proud of you my boy!" she gushed. "Love you and your beautiful soul."
